It does look like an Amanita, but, as thosemynikes suggested, I don't think it's in section Phalloidae of subgenus Lepidella (where the Destroying Angels are). The volva is incorrect, not appearing saccate.

If I had to make a wild guess I'd probably try section Amanita of subgenus Amanita. Another possibility would be section Lepidella of subgenus Lepidella. To be certain of which it is we need to see if the spores are amyloid.

For accurate identification of mushrooms you really need to pick them (make sure you get the entire mushroom, including the base of the stem) and bring them home. That way you can answer questions you didn't think of while in the field.

Interesting picture. I have seen a blue/green mold growing on Psathyrella species before. The mold had started on the stump and worked its way up to the mushroom stem.

Something to keep in mind for those beginners who seek actives - careful not to confuse this sort of thing for bluing.
A lot of times, if it's a mold, some of it will wipe off if you brush it with a moist cloth.
